New cold front brings heavy rain and gale warnings to Rio Grande do Sul

Africa2 hr ago

Rio Grande do Sul, Brazil, is bracing for a new cold front arriving on Saturday, October 1st, accompanied by severe weather warnings including thunderstorms and winds up to 100 km/h. This comes as the state is still grappling with the aftermath of recent heavy rains, which have already caused seven injuries and impacted 143 municipalities. Currently, 690 people are displaced and 856 are homeless due to the ongoing climate events.

The National Institute of Meteorology (Inmet) has issued danger alerts for thunderstorms and gales, forecasting up to 100 millimeters of rain per day, hail, and intense winds ranging from 60 to 100 km/h. The most affected regions include the Southwest, Southeast, Northwest, West-Central, East-Central, Northeast, Mountain, and the Porto Alegre Metropolitan area. Porto Alegre's Civil Defense also issued a warning for strong winds and rain showers valid from Saturday evening until Sunday morning.

River levels are a significant concern, with the state Civil Defense issuing "very high" flood risk warnings for the Guaíba River, particularly in the Ilhas region of Porto Alegre, and the Sinos River, affecting São Leopoldo and Novo Hamburgo. While levels in the Guaíba Basin are expected to stabilize and then gradually decline, other basins like Taquari and Caí are seeing falling water levels. The Uruguai River basin shows mixed behavior, with rising levels in the Middle Uruguai and São Borja, and falling levels in Itaqui and Uruguaiana. In Cachoeirinha, sandbags have been deployed to reinforce vulnerable areas against potential flooding from the Gravataí River, which has reached its flood stage. Despite a return to stable weather expected for most of Sunday, instability is forecast to return on Monday, October 3rd, with potential for isolated storms and winds up to 80 km/h, continuing into Tuesday, October 4th.
